First things first: Are you even qualified to be a service doggo overlord?

The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) is the ultimate rulebook for service animals. In short, you gotta have a disability that affects your daily life, and your canine companion needs to be trained to perform specific tasks that directly lessen the impact of that disability. Think seeing-eye dogs, hearing assistance dogs, or even pups trained to pick things up you've dropped (because, let's be honest, that's a struggle for all of us sometimes).

Now that we've established you're not after a glorified cuddle monster (although, side cuddles are a definite perk), let's explore your options for acquiring a service dog in Houston!

  • Adoption Redemption: Houston has some fantastic organizations like Give Us Paws that specialize in training service dogs, often placing a priority on veterans. They might even have a perfectly-trained pup waiting for their forever human (that's you!).

  • Puppy Preschool: Feeling the urge to nurture a future service star from a tiny ball of fluff? Organizations like Puptown Houston offer training programs where you get matched with a service dog in training. Think of it as doggy daycare with a higher purpose (and possibly more drool). Just remember, this option requires a bigger time commitment (and a stronger vacuum cleaner).

  • DIY Dog Academy: Ever dreamt of being Cesar Millan with a slightly less intimidating reputation? You can actually train your own service dog, but be warned, this is the ultimate doggy university course. It takes serious dedication and likely involves the help of a professional trainer to ensure your pup is up to the service dog standards.

No matter which route you choose, remember, getting a service dog is a marathon, not a sprint. There will be applications, training, and possibly enough slobbery mishaps to fill a swimming pool. But the rewards? A loyal companion who makes your life a whole lot easier (and way cuter).
